TAMPAN Issues Statement on Failed Concert as Portable Arrives Hours Late
An Ilorin-based hospitality centre, known as TAMPAN, has distanced itself from any responsibility regarding the recent failure of a concert involving hip-hop artist Habeeb Okikiola, popularly known as Portable, and the Theatre Arts and Motion Pictures Practitioners Association of Nigeria.
Nigerian Tribune reports suggest that the concert, scheduled for midday on 29th September 2024 at Starwood Hotels 02 Arena, did not take place as expected, with Portable allegedly arriving at 4:06 am on 30th September 2024.
In a statement released by the Arena's management, signed by Ayodele Femi, it was disclosed that "Portable later requested to perform later that night, which required additional logistical arrangements and extended use of equipment."
“We feel it is important to clarify our position and dissociate our establishment from his actions.
“The event was intended to be a prestigious gathering, with notable figures, celebrities, and a wide range of attendees looking forward to Portable's performance at the concert Arena in Ilorin, which showcases the venue's cutting-edge technology and unparalleled sophistication.
“Despite being scheduled to perform at 12:00 pm, Portable did not arrive until 4:06 am on September 30, well after the event had been concluded and attendees had departed in disappointment.
“However, to our shock and dismay, Portable abandoned the hotel and the city by the evening of September 30, leaving without performing and causing further inconveniences to the organisers and guests.
“We wish to categorically state that Starwood Hotels O2 Arena had no involvement in, nor do we condone any disruption of the fiesta.
“Our hotel management and staff maintained the highest standards of professionalism throughout his stay, and we strongly distance ourselves from his conduct.
“Our priority has always been the comfort and satisfaction of our guests, and we deeply regret any inconvenience caused by Portable's actions during his stay in our hotel and in the city of Ilorin.”.
